The Working-Class Library – Live Podcast with special guest author

Join writer Richard Benson (The Farm, The Valley) and Claire Malcolm (New Writing North) from the Working Class Library podcast as they seek to explore and reclaim working-class people’s contribution to English literature. Their quest is to establish a new ‘canon’ of working-class books that tell a different story to the established British literary canon. For this live edition of the podcast they will be joined by special guest Kevin Barry to talk about Frank McCourt’s Angela’s Ashes, a working-class classic that they love. The podcast is a venture of The Bee, a new magazine of writing by working class writers which launches this spring.
